Jahrom is a city in Fars province, Iran.
It is located 190 km south east of Shiraz, the capital of Fars province.
Many tropical and sub tropical plants are grown there (i.e. palm date, citrus, wheat).
The biggest hand-made cave in the world is in the south of Jahrom and is called "Sang-shekan Cave". The people of Jahrom are Shi'a Muslims and speak Persian.
There are two major universities in the city.
Jahrom has a population of over 250,000.
